• Commissioners proceed with Animal Control site

  • Even though he's still opposed to the site, Leavenworth City Commissioner Davis Moulden said Tuesday he won't make any further effort to move the location of a new Animal Control center.

    And his fellow commissioners reached a consensus Tuesday to put out the project for bids.

      In other business:
      When they met Tuesday, Leavenworth city commissioners took up the following issues:

      They listened to Dee Ketchum, marketing consultant for the Delaware Tribe of Indians. He discussed plans to move the tribal headquarters to Kansas, possibly in the Leavenworth area.

      They reached a consensus for advancing a ordinance to prohibit littering.
